Output 2f7cd60efface3991dd7e210b05ee5b69d10016cb3b79a538b530570042f4f5b:1

value
1466267770
script pubkey
OP_0 OP_PUSHBYTES_20 c884a07346ecb7fe2c645a4f8127d0c245bcc560
address
bc1qezz2qu6xajmlutrytf8czf7scfzme3tqtrj0ck
transaction
2f7cd60efface3991dd7e210b05ee5b69d10016cb3b79a538b530570042f4f5b
spent
true